



當當物流接口 API 對接技巧,電商物流對接不用愁!
kdniao
來源:互聯網 | 2025-07-18 11:43:46
在電商領域,物流環節的效率和可靠性直接影響用戶體驗和商家口碑。對于需要通過當當物流接口 API實現快速對接的平臺來說,掌握核心技巧能夠大幅減少開發周期并提升整體流程的穩定性。本文將圍繞對接準備、接口調用流程、錯誤處理等關鍵環節展開,幫助開發者輕松應對技術挑戰。
在正式調用API之前,必須明確業務需求和技術規范。首先,確認物流服務的具體功能,例如下單、軌跡查詢、運費計算等,并與當當物流的接口文檔進行匹配。此外,注冊開發者賬號并申請API權限是基礎步驟,需提前準備好企業的認證信息和簽名密鑰。
技術層面,重點關注接口的認證方式和參數格式。大多數物流接口采用Token或數字簽名進行身份驗證,需在代碼中妥善保存密鑰,避免泄漏。參數方面,需嚴格按照文檔要求傳遞必填字段(如訂單號、收件地址等),同時確保數據編碼與接口一致,例如日期格式、地址分段的規則。
調用當當物流接口 API的核心步驟可分為認證獲取、請求構建和響應處理三個階段。
認證獲取是調用的前提。以Token為例,開發者需先通過賬號和密鑰申請臨時令牌,并在后續請求的Header中攜帶該令牌。通常Token存在有效期,需要設計定時刷新的機制以維持接口可用性。
請求構建需要關注接口的通信協議和數據格式。例如,若接口支持RESTful風格,需正確拼接URL路徑并選擇GET或POST方法;若涉及數據傳輸,JSON或XML需根據接口要求封裝數據。一個常見錯誤是忽略字段類型,例如將數字誤傳為字符串,導致接口返回參數異常。
響應處理環節需兼顧成功和失敗場景。對于成功響應,需解析返回的物流單號、路由信息等關鍵數據,并同步更新本地數據庫;對于錯誤響應(如HTTP狀態碼異常),需記錄錯誤碼和描述,結合文檔排查問題,例如檢查參數是否遺漏或格式錯誤。
在物流對接中,數據一致性是重中之重。訂單狀態(如已發貨、已簽收)需與物流系統的信息保持同步。建議通過異步任務或消息隊列處理回調通知,避免因網絡延遲導致數據不同步。此外,定期對賬機制能幫助發現數據差異,例如對比本地訂單與接口返回的物流狀態是否一致。
針對常見的錯誤場景,開發者需建立系統的錯誤處理策略。例如:
高頻調用物流接口可能面臨性能瓶頸,優化手段包括:
此外,接口版本的升級可能影響現有功能,建議定期查閱官方文檔,并在測試環境中驗證新版本的兼容性。
以“運費計算”功能為例,某電商平臺在對接時發現返回的運費與實際預期不符。經排查,原因是未正確傳遞商品的體積參數,而接口默認按重量計費。修正參數后問題得以解決。此案例說明,參數完整性和業務邏輯的匹配度直接影響接口調用的準確性。
另一個常見問題是訂單超時未返回物流單號。這通常由接口響應慢或回調地址配置錯誤引起。解決方法包括優化服務器網絡環境、增加超時閾值,以及檢查回調地址的可訪問性。
通過以上步驟,開發者能夠更高效地完成當當物流接口 API的對接工作。合理的規劃、嚴謹的測試以及持續優化,不僅能提升對接效率,還能為終端用戶提供流暢的物流體驗。在電商競爭日益激烈的當下,物流能力已成為商家脫穎而出的關鍵,而技術對接的可靠性正是這一能力的堅實保障。
相關產品推薦
相關方案推薦
依托德邦全網布局及大件能力,通過自主研發OMS、WMS、TMS,實現企業供應鏈系統集成與數據交換為客戶提供一站式倉儲配送等綜合服務。目前聚焦于快消、家具、家電等行業,可為客戶提供定制化解決方案、精細化倉儲管理、定制化系統、專業配送及安裝、客服及項目管理、供應鏈金融等服務。
梳理企業業務流程,制定流程標準,配合系統簡化操作步驟,實現準確,標準工作模式
京東物流致力于為客戶提供從原產地、生產加工源頭到末端消費者的全環節一站式供應鏈服務。通過物流覆蓋全國的冷鏈倉運配網絡,為客戶提供優質的基礎物流保障。通過大數據驅動和科技賦能,建立食品供應鏈的全程溯源及可視化體系,并通過自動化設備、倉網規劃、智能預測的應用,助力客戶數智化轉型,和客戶共同打造可追溯、智能、敏捷的供應鏈。